Have you ever eaten something, felt fine, and then hours later or even the next day felt terrible and wondered, was that gluten?
Delayed gluten reactions are incredibly common, but they're also incredibly confusing. Today we're going to talk about why gluten reactions aren't always immediate, what happens in the body, and how to think about delayed symptoms without spiraling into anxiety. If you've ever second-guessed yourself after a reaction, this episode is for you.
